WebFeb 27, 2024 · A perforated peptic ulcer is a rare cause of acute right iliac fossa or lower quadrant abdominal pain. It causes leakage of gastrointestinal contents in the area, resulting in localized inflammation and pain that is clinically similar to acute appendicitis. This condition is known as Valentino’s syndrome. The typical imaging features of acute cholecystitis are as follows: … WebWhat is cholelithiasis? Cholelithiasis, or gallstones, are hardened deposits of digestive fluid that form in the gallbladder. The gallbladder is a small, pear-shaped organ that lies beneath the liver and stores bile made by the liver.
